Unlocking Your Data: Top Polynote Alternatives for Enhanced Notebook Experiences
Polynote, with its innovative approach to mixing multiple languages and fostering reproducible notebooks, has carved out a unique space in the data science landscape. Its immutable data model and seamless data sharing capabilities are undeniably powerful. However, as with any specialized tool, there are scenarios where a different approach might better suit your workflow or specific project requirements. Whether you're looking for broader language support, a more established community, or a different set of features, exploring Polynote alternatives can open up new possibilities for your data exploration and analysis.
Top Polynote Alternatives
If you're seeking to expand your horizons beyond Polynote, a wealth of robust and feature-rich alternatives are available. These tools offer diverse functionalities, platform compatibility, and community support, ensuring you can find the perfect fit for your interactive computing needs.

Jupyter
Jupyter is a cornerstone of interactive data science and scientific computing, offering an open-source, browser-based environment that supports over 40 programming languages. As a highly versatile Polynote alternative, it excels in interactive visualization and literate programming, making it ideal for sharing your analysis. It's available across multiple platforms including Free, Open Source, Mac, Windows, Linux, Web, and Cloudron, and boasts features like server-side execution and support for multiple languages, providing a comprehensive solution for diverse computational tasks.

RStudio
RStudio™ is an integrated development environment (IDE) specifically designed for R, making it a strong Polynote alternative for those deeply entrenched in statistical computing. It offers an intuitive user interface combined with powerful coding tools, enhancing productivity for R users. This open-source IDE is available on Free, Open Source, Mac, Windows, Linux, and Xfce platforms, and includes valuable features such as code completion, an embedded debugger, and syntax highlighting, providing a complete environment for R development.

IPython
IPython serves as an enhanced interactive shell for Python, providing a powerful Polynote alternative for Python-centric workflows. It offers features like enhanced introspection, additional shell syntax, syntax highlighting, and tab completion, significantly improving the interactive Python experience. Being free and open-source, IPython is accessible on Mac, Windows, and Linux, focusing primarily on Python development.

Scilab
Scilab is a free and open-source scientific software package for numerical computations, offering a robust Polynote alternative for engineering and scientific applications. It provides a powerful open computing environment for various numerical tasks. Available on Mac, Windows, and Linux, Scilab is a comprehensive tool for those needing a dedicated environment for numerical analysis.

Spyder
Spyder (previously known as Pydee) is a free, open-source Python development environment that provides MATLAB-like features, making it an excellent Polynote alternative for Python developers. It's a simple and light-weighted software available on Mac, Windows, and Linux, offering specific features tailored for Python development and serving as a dedicated Python IDE.

nteract
nteract is a desktop application that enables the creation of rich documents combining prose, executable code in almost any language, and images. As a user-friendly Polynote alternative, nteract simplifies the development of interactive documents. It's free and open-source, available on Mac, Windows, and Linux, and integrates well with other tools like Apache Zeppelin and Jupyter.

Beaker
The Beaker Notebook is a free and open-source tool for research and data science, making it a compelling Polynote alternative. Its advanced UI prioritizes focusing on data and scientific tasks rather than tool complexities. Available on Mac, Windows, and Linux, Beaker supports features like Business Intelligence, Data Mining, and Machine Learning, catering to a broad range of data-intensive applications.

Eve
Eve is a programming language and IDE that uniquely focuses on the human programmer rather than the machine. As a distinct Polynote alternative, it adopts a document-based approach where programs resemble structured documents. It's free and open-source, available on Mac, Windows, and Linux, offering a fresh perspective on programming and interaction.

Kajero
Kajero offers interactive JavaScript notebooks, allowing users to create good-looking, responsive, and interactive documents. This free and open-source Polynote alternative is available on Mac, Windows, Linux, Web, and Self-Hosted environments, integrating well with platforms like GitHub for collaborative document creation.

µCalc
µCalc (mucalc) is a multi-user math web app, providing a real-time collaborative Polynote alternative for mathematical computations. Its math syntax is parsed in the browser by math.js, and a node.js backend with socket.io handles synchronization. This free and open-source web application is self-hosted with Node.JS, offering features like calculators, LaTeX support, multiple user support, real-time collaboration, and a unit converter.
The world of interactive notebooks and development environments is rich and diverse. While Polynote offers unique advantages, exploring these alternatives will undoubtedly help you find a tool that perfectly aligns with your specific needs for language support, collaboration, features, and overall workflow. Take the time to experiment and discover the best fit for your data science journey.